The Ninth Special Olympics Walk-a-Thon to Be Held Sunday April 3, 2011

The always popular Walk-a-Thon will be held this year on Sunday April 3, 2011. It is a 30 kilometer event (18.6 miles) and follows the historical route from the slave huts to Rincon. Proceeds from the event go to the local chapter of Special Olympics.

The event starts at 5:00 AM with stops for water and snacks scheduled every five kilometers (3 miles). The final stop is at Karpata, which is being sponsored by the Bonaire Bikers Club. Food and drinks will be available at the finish line for all participants and a lunch will be served at Pasdia Karino Rincon from 9:00 AM through 12:30 PM. Participants may walk, run, bicycle or roller blade the route, and they may choose to do the entire route or just a portion. EHBO will provide a van for bikes of any participants who are unable to complete the ride.

The entry fee is $15 per person which includes an event t-shirt along with water and snacks along the route. Registration cards are available in advance at TCB, Chat ‘n Browse, Lovers Ice Cream or a Board Member of the Special Olympics.

Participants may pick up their t-shirt at City Cafe on Friday April 1st from 5:00 to 7:00 PM or Saturday April 2nd from 10:00 AM to 4:00 PM.
